
'Isang' leaves PAR, storm signals lifted - Pagasa
MANILA, Philippines — The Philippine Atmospheric, Geophysical and Astronomical Services Administration (Pagasa) said Tropical Storm "Isang" has left the Philippine Area of Responsibility (PAR). In its 11 a.m. bulletin on Saturday, the weather bureau said "Isang" was estimated 440 kilometers West of Bacnotan, La Union.
